VFX of Inception and Doctor Strange

What it does

Distorting the ground in the real world to provide a new view of the world

How I built it

  • Transformed the vertex coordinates of the plane detected by the plane tracker into the clip space
  • Deformed the vertex position.

Challenges I ran into

  • Converting world space to clip space
  • Vertex displacement
  • UI/UX design for this filter

Accomplishments that I'm proud of

Found a new way to use SparkAR

What I learned

  • Vertex shader in SparkAR
  • Matrix transform

What's next for Distortion World

  • Distort buildings

Built With

  • matrixprojection
  • shaders
  • sparkar
